Recoutering, -cowtering, vbl. n. [f. Recouter,v.] The action of mending or refurbishing. — 1538 Treasurer's Accounts VII 35.
The recowtering and mending of the uther weschel witht the four buttonis forsaid
1538 Ib. 37.
For ane blak welvot hatt and for the sewing and recoutering of the samin
1539 Ib. 50.
For ane greit puncheoun, canwes, hay and for recoutering [pr. recountering] of the samin
